how long does clean cycle take on viking oven
The clean cycle on a Viking oven can take anywhere from 2 to 4 hours to complete. The exact duration of the self-clean cycle depends on the model and the level of soiling inside the oven. During the self-clean process, the oven's temperature rises to extremely high levels (typically around 900°F or 482°C) to burn off and eliminate built-up grease, food residues, and other debris from the interior surfaces. It's essential to follow the manufacturer's instructions and safety guidelines while using the self-clean feature. Additionally, ensure proper ventilation during the cleaning process to prevent smoke and odors from affecting the surrounding area. Always wait until the oven cools down and the lock indicator light turns off before opening the oven door after completing the clean cycle.
